Please note that the mail room has moved from the ground floor of Harrowgate House to Level 2, beside the Quillon meeting suite. Visitors collecting parcels must sign in at reception, present photo identification, and be escorted at all times; under no circumstances should a visitor enter the mail room unaccompanied. Couriers use the rear loading bay only. Reception staff escorting visitors to the new mail room should unlock the Level 2 corridor door using the code below.

badge for fafop-fajof: bdg-Z-47

**CI note: GraphQL N+1 fix (Lattica API).** Dataloader batching added to the `orders.lineItems` resolver. If the `query-count` CI gate fails again, check that the loader is request-scoped — a module-level instance caused cross-request cache bleed once. Regression test lives in `spec/nplusone`. Fix verified against the artifact whose trace token appears below.

trace token, kawip-fafog: htk14_26e64c4d35154e

Subject: Handover — Paylark export format change

Hi,

Taking over release duty from Marit tonight. The Paylark payroll export switched from fixed-width to delimited in build 4.12, so downstream at Fennwick Accounting needs the new manifest before Friday's run. Rollback is build 4.11, already staged. Nothing else in flight. The export bundle must be re-signed before upload; use the key below.

release key, kagaf-tahop: bky6_tFmur5

Session Handling — Moonpool Tide Widget

The Moonpool widget maintains a short-lived session per embedded instance, refreshed every 15 minutes against the Saltmere session service. Sessions carry only the station identifier and display preferences; no user data is persisted client-side. On refresh failure, the widget falls back to cached tide tables for up to six hours. For the sync demo, the staging session service validates requests against the token that follows.

session JWT of yawep-yawep = eyJhbGciOiJIUzI1NiIsInR5cCI6IkpXVCJ9.eyJzdWIiOiI3pWF3_In0.aXYsHiog